Kodak EASYSHARE Z1085 IS
The last in the Z series — EasyShare Z1085 IS — is the camera that “takes brilliant pictures. You take the credit.” It’s a 10 mega-pixel camera and has a 5x optical zoom with optical image stabilization.
It features smart capture, face detection technology and convenient battery options. It comes with a high ISO, up to 8,000.
Kodak EASYSHARE Z1285 Zoom
The EasyShare Z1285 is all about the HD — you can take stunning pictures and record excellent quality videos in HD with this camera. It comes with a 12 mega-pixel sensor and a 5x Schneider-Kreuznach Variogon optical zoom lens.
You can capture beautiful HD pictures in 16:9 format, and for viewing you can purchase the Kodak Easyshare HDTV Dock.
Kodak EASYSHARE Z8612
The first Kodak cam in the Z series is the EasyShare Z8612. This camera is all about the zoom. It comes with a 8.1 mega-pixel sensor and a whopping 12x optical zoom with optical image stabilization.
You can take HD pictures and also purchase the optional Kodak EasyShare HDTV Dock. The Z8612 has a high ISO (up to 3200) and features smart scene mode.
Kodak EASYSHARE V1073
The next in the V series is the EasyShare V1073. It looks pretty similar to the V1273 and is pretty much the same feature-wise as well, although this one “only” comes with a 10 mega-pixel sensor.
The V1073 has a large 3-inch touch screen LCD and features smart capture mode. It can take still images in HD and the 10 mega-pixels allows you to print up to 30×40 inches (76×102 cm).
Kodak EASYSHARE V1273

The first new camera in Kodak’s V series is the EasyShare V1273. The V1273 has a massive 12 mega-pixels and comes with 3x optical zoom and a large 3-inch touch screen LCD.
It can capture still images in HD and record in HD also. It features optical image stabilization, multimedia slide show and face detection technology.
Kodak EASYSHARE M763
The new Kodak EasyShare M763, the last one in the M series, is pretty much the same as the EasyShare M863, but this one comes with only 7.2 mega-pixels. As far as everything else goes, I can’t see any differences between the two. Both cameras come with 3x optical zoom, HD still image function, face detection, digital image stabilization and the Li-Ion rechargeable battery.
Kodak EASYSHARE M863
The next new camera in Kodak’s M Series is the EasyShare M863. The “pocket full of style” camera features 8.2 mega-pixels and comes with a 3x optical zoom lens. It also comes with the HD still image function, which allows you to print large, crisp beautiful images in HD.
The EasyShare M863 also features the face detection function, as well as the Li-Ion rechargeable battery, which is always handy.
